Lexus IS-F and LF-A

Lexus IS-F and LF-A

Lexus is 18 years old in 2007 and like most car crazy people of that age it wants to go fast. Famed across the world as the maker of the most luxurious and refined cars, Lexus has now added speed and performance to the mix with two new sports cars unveiled at the Detroit Motor Show.

MIA joins forces with UK Trade & Investment at Autosport International

The Motorsport Industry Association (MIA) is once again running a huge schedule of business events alongside this year’s Autosport International Show, January 11-14, NEC, Birmingham. The non-stop programme includes hosting a major group of overseas buyers, an exciting series of FREE business workshops and seminars, a number of on-stand launches and the UK motorsport industry’s largest annual awards event.

Taking in-car entertainment to new heights

Taking in-car entertainment to new heights

Jaguar’s new C-XF concept car, unveiled at the Detroit Motor Show, features next generation audio solutions from renowned sound expert Bowers & Wilkins. Emphasising the company’s reputation for audio excellence and innovation, Bowers & Wilkins’ first foray into the automotive entertainment arena reveals a range of technologies, materials and techniques, many of which make their debut.
